Alphonse Ouellet was born in Jun 1856. He was the son of Christophe Ouellet and Modeste Thériau. At age 23, Alphonse married Eugenie Gagnon on 12 Aug 1879 in L'Isle-Vert. There are nine known children born into this marriage. Alphonse died at age 70 on 3 Jan 1927 in Saint-Épiphane in Rivière-du-Loup.
